Yes, a good CGPA is required to get good placements. If you have reappears of backlogs then they will not let you sit in placement drive actually they required 6.50 CGPA. And maintaining a good CGPA is a sign of a good student. Apart from this LPU do a lot of hard work to get their student placed. They give students PEP classes. In which students can enhance their communication skills and interpersonal skills which is most important in terms of interview points of view.

Hello
Great interacting with you. Most of the companies want 6 to 6.5 CGPA. If you have minimum CGPA still you will be able to sit for 70 to 75% of the companies However, there are some companies who want it around 8.5. It is just a threshold set by companies to filter students. If u have CGPA more than 8.5 you will be eligible for 100% of the companies. Having a 7 CGPA with skills is far better than having a 9 CGPA with zero skillset. Companies are not looking for bookworms. They are looking for skilled individuals. The applicant should give the relevant Class 10 and 12 mark sheets and certificates, along with the LPUNEST admit card and scorecard, recent passport-sized photographs-a valid photo ID/birth proof such as Aadhaar or matric certificate, and category certificates, if applicable-with any qualifying or eligibility certificates for the selected program under LPU NEST counseling.
Mainly an online process, LPU NEST Counselling enables qualified candidates to fill in seat preferences, upload documents, and make payments remotely. On such occasions, candidates might deposit fees offline, visit the university campus or camp office, or submit their applications. As per preference, seat allotment occurs according to merit ranks, while results can be viewed online.
